For the seventh straight year, friends of Troy University worked together to once again surpass the goal set for the University’s annual TROY Giving Day.

Donors raised $444,797 from more than 340 gifts from 27 states—and Canada, France and Germany—in the 24-hour period, exceeding the $300,000 goal.

John "Doc" Anderson had an impact on the lives of countless athletic training students during his long career at Troy University.

The Sports Science Lab in Troy University’s new Jones Hall will bear the name of a TROY icon – John “Doc” Anderson.

In honor of her time at Troy University, senior Jane Vickers and her family have started the Pike Community Scholarship that will provide tuition for four years to a student from Pike County.
